How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Absarokee?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Absarokee Studio Apartments | $1,456 | $795 | $7,030 |
Absarokee 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,359 | $600 | $4,833 |
Absarokee 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,581 | $795 | $2,420 |
Absarokee 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,530 | $1,215 | $8,698 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Absarokee
How much are Studio apartments in Absarokee?
There are currently 10 Studio Apartments in Absarokee with rent ranges from $795 to $7,030 with an average price of $1,456.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Absarokee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Absarokee ranges from $600 to $4,833 with an average monthly rent of $1,359.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Absarokee c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Absarokee range from $795 to $2,420.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,581.
How expensive are Absarokee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 15 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Absarokee on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,215 to $8,698 - averaging $2,530 for the location.
